Samsung unveils new Corby series phone Corby II GT-S3850


Bangalore: Samsung has unveiled the latest Corby series phone, Corby II GT-S3850, at the Samsung SEA Forum in Singapore. Coming in a distinct design, its features include Social Hub, support for Microsoft Exchange, TouchWiz UI, T9 QuickType keyboard integrated and email client. The price of the new handset has not been announced. With a 3.14-inch touchscreen display, Corby II GT-S3850 has quad-band GSM/EDGE support. It is a 2G network only phone and doesn't support 3G network. The highlighting features of the new handset are 2MP camera, microSD card slot (up to 16GB), Bluetooth 3.0, Wi-Fi 802.11b/g/n, FM Radio, 3.5mm headphone jack along with a 1000mAh battery that the company claims will allow up to 9.5 hours in talk time. Samsung said the new phone will be available in Germany in late March and then other countries in Europe, Latin America, India, China, Middle East and Africa. The company also showcased its new QWERTY candybar Galaxy Pro at the Samsung SEA Forum. The device runs Google Android 2.2 Froyo on it and is powered by an 800MHz CPU.
